About AAG
Alliance Automotive Group (AAG) is a leading distributor of passenger and commercial vehicle parts to the independent automotive aftermarket in Europe. It operates in the United Kingdom, Ireland, France, Germany, Poland, Spain, Portugal, Belgium, and the Netherlands.
The company is a wholly owned subsidiary of Genuine Parts Company (GPC), the largest worldwide automotive parts distributor with activities in North America, Europe, and Australasia. AAG’s network is serving thousands of customers across Europe supported by a logistics infrastructure of 80 Distribution Centers, 2,455 Stores as well as 7,590 Repair Centers.
The AAG has a revenue of 3.1 billion euros with over 17,000 employees. Learn more at www.allianceautomotivegroup.eu.
